No, not really. The very nature of jpeg is not unlike mp3. You can save it as a level 12/100% quality (or 320kps for mp3) and have little perceived loss, but it still doesn't have all the data that the original had. Plus, these jpegs are pretty small (30-50kb), and therefore I can say with certainty they aren't even close to lossless.desirecampbell wrote:Jpeg can be saved losslessly, as this comparrison appears to be.
Moreover, interesting as it is, they weren't even saved the same way. The Spanish screencaps are consistantly 10kb larger than the Japanese, so...yeah. Shitty comparison all around.
